Oracle数据库入门教程:从基础到实践
需积分: 18 127 浏览量
更新于2024-07-26
收藏 1.64MB PDF 举报
"Oracle数据库实用教程,适合初学者,涵盖了数据库基础、数据管理历程、数据库分类等内容,重点介绍了关系型数据库和SQL语言的基础知识。"
本教程主要针对Oracle数据库的初学者,旨在帮助读者理解数据库的基本概念并掌握Oracle的相关知识。首先,教程介绍了数据库基础,包括数据库(Database, DB)、数据库管理系统(Database Management System, DBMS)、数据库管理员(Database Administrator, DBA)以及数据库系统(Database System, DBS)的角色和功能。在这一部分,特别强调了数据库系统中的构成元素,如应用程序、数据库和最终用户之间的关系。
接着,教程深入讲解了关系型数据库(Relationship Database, RDB)及其管理系统(RDBMS),这是目前最广泛使用的数据库类型。关系型数据库以二维表格的形式存储数据,并且规定了数据之间的关系。SQL(Structured Query Language)作为与这些数据库交互的语言,被用来执行各种操作,如查询、插入、删除、更新数据,创建和删除数据库对象等。教程列举了SQL的一些核心指令,如SELECT、INSERT、DELETE、UPDATE、CREATE和DROP。
教程还概述了数据管理的三个历程:手工管理阶段、文件管理阶段和数据库管理阶段,强调了数据库管理阶段的优势,如数据共享性和独立性。此外,还提到了数据库的发展历程,从非关系型数据库系统到关系型数据库系统,再到对象-关系数据库系统的演变。
在数据库分类部分,教程简要介绍了网状数据库、层次型数据库和关系型数据库的特点。关系型数据库以其易于理解和操作的二维表格结构,成为现代企业级数据管理的首选,例如Oracle、IBM DB2、SQL Server、SyBase和Informix等。
通过学习本教程,初学者可以建立起对Oracle数据库和数据库管理的基本认识,为进一步深入学习和实践打下坚实的基础。
2014-07-23 上传
2009-03-15 上传
2017-08-19 上传
2020-08-19 上传
2022-03-11 上传
2014-09-28 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
W大曼
- 粉丝: 0
- 资源: 1
最新资源
- 黑板风格计算机毕业答辩PPT模板下载
- CodeSandbox实现ListView快速创建指南
- Node.js脚本实现WXR文件到Postgres数据库帖子导入
- 清新简约创意三角毕业论文答辩PPT模板
- DISCORD-JS-CRUD:提升 Discord 机器人开发体验
- Node.js v4.3.2版本Linux ARM64平台运行时环境发布
- SQLight:C++11编写的轻量级MySQL客户端
- 计算机专业毕业论文答辩PPT模板
- Wireshark网络抓包工具的使用与数据包解析
- Wild Match Map: JavaScript中实现通配符映射与事件绑定
- 毕业答辩利器:蝶恋花毕业设计PPT模板
- Node.js深度解析:高性能Web服务器与实时应用构建
- 掌握深度图技术:游戏开发中的绚丽应用案例
- Dart语言的HTTP扩展包功能详解
- MoonMaker: 投资组合加固神器,助力$GME投资者登月
- 计算机毕业设计答辩PPT模板下载